用的专题提供用的的最新资讯内容,帮你更好的了解用的。
xshell 配置   .vimrc 配置 set nocompatible set bs=indent,eol,start set history=50 set ruler filetype plugin on set encoding=utf-8 set termencoding=utf-8 set fileencoding=utf-8 set fencs=utf-8,gb18030,gb23
在Bash脚本中,是否可以在“尚未使用的编号最小的文件描述符”上打开文件? 我已经找到了如何做到这一点,但似乎Bash总是要求你指定的数字,例如。喜欢这个: exec 3< /path/to/a/file # Open file for reading on file descriptor 3. 相比之下,我想能够做一些事情 my_file_descriptor=$(open_r /path
生活中经常遇到的一件事情我想是,领导给你一堆IP,让你去telnet测试下网络连通性,这时候你就需要写一个shell小脚本去高效的执行了。以下是我在生产环境上试验过的,不一定是最优的代码,当我想应该也够用了。 共有两种情况: 第一种情况是每个IP的端口都不固定 IPs_Port.txt 存放的文件是 192.168.1.1 4949 192.168.2.3 9090 cat IPs_Port.tx
关于环境变量,我有一个非常有趣的问题,谷歌搜索并没有向我显示任何有意义的结果: $echo $BUCKET && python -c "import os; print os.environ['BUCKET']" mule-uploader-demo Traceback (most recent call last): File "<string>", line 1, in <module>
最近自己的redhat上python升级了python到2.7,却发现yum无法使用了,找到了一个可行的解决办法,大家可以参考一下,转载了网友的一篇文章,亲测有效。 转载自:http://www.cnblogs.com/theitnotes/p/4162882.html 由于CentOS的yum是采用的Python2.4.X进行开发的,所以不支持更高版本的python安装,所以需要进行手工的安装。
今天安装oracle 数据库,安装时 有两个依赖包需要安装分别为 compat-libstdc++-33-3.2.3-61.i386.rpm glibc-2.3.4-2.41.x86_64.rpm 于是就百度一下安装了起来: [root@x ~]# rpm -ivh *.rpm warning: compat-libstdc++-33-3.2.3-61.i386.rpm: Header V3 DS
如何在网络上找到未使用的IP地址? DHCP服务器保持分配相同的地址,我需要一个不同的IP地址来测试我的应用程序.该软件需要在 Windows上运行. 可能最好的方法是在ARP Ping扫描模式下使用NMAP( http://nmap.org/).用法类似于nmap -sP -PR 192.168.0.*(或者您的网络). 此方法的优点是它使用地址解析协议来检测是否将IP地址分配给计算机.任何想要
此Wiki的目的是促进使用命令打开常用应用程序,而无需经过多次鼠标点击 – 从而节省了监视和排除 Windows机器故障的时间. 答案条目需要指定 >申请名称 >命令 >截图(可选) 命令的快捷方式 > && – Command Chaining > %SYSTEMROOT%\System32\rcimlby.exe -LaunchRA – 远程协助(Windows XP) > appwiz.cp
无论如何通过 Windows共享来识别最后[在此处插入时间框架](对我来说是去年内部)内部未访问过的文件? 我可以访问服务器,只能通过Windows共享访问文件,而不能从服务器本身访问. 该份额有70GB的数据(NTFS).它有数十万个文件分布在数百个文件夹中.混合使用MS Office相关文件,大图像,程序等. 我主要是一名程序员,我很高兴“通过这样做’回答你自己的问题……但我希望在Window
在我的工作场所,我们继承了运行 Windows 2008 R2的文件服务器. (核心服务器不幸,所以没有GUI) 去年我们决定为用户提供以前版本的文件会很不错.所以我们给VSS一个单独的卷,占据了数据量的10%. (分别为300GB和3TB)我们设置了一个计划任务,每天拍摄两张VSS快照,每次拍摄都很好.以前的版本很好地展示了. 最近,以前的版本只是消失了,我找不到原因.我检查了行政股是否有效,他
我们有一个全天候使用的生产服务器,在Hyper-v中运行.来宾操作系统是Server 2008 R2.它具有动态扩展的VHDX,非常接近达到最大尺寸.是否可以在没有停机的情况下缩小它? 我见过使用sdelete -z的建议,但其中一个问题是VHDX所在的物理驱动器容量为1.79TB(目前为52.1 GB),VHDX的最大大小为1.82TB,所以我不知道使用sdelete是否会导致VM失败/暂停,如
1.是否为数字    Regex rx = new Regex(@"^[+-]?[0123456789]*[.]?[0123456789]*$");   http://www.dtan.so 2.是否只包含字母与数字    Regex rx = new Regex(@"^[a-zA-Z0-9-]*$");   3.是否是身份证    Regex rx = new Regex(@"^[0123456
下面都是我收集的一些比较常用的正则表达式,因为平常可能在表单验证的时候,用到的比较多。特发出来,让各位朋友共同使用。呵呵。 匹配中文字符的正则表达式: [u4e00-u9fa5] 评注:匹配中文还真是个头疼的事,有了这个表达式就好办了 匹配双字节字符(包括汉字在内):[^x00-xff] 评注:可以用来计算字符串的长度(一个双字节字符长度计2,ASCII字符计1) 匹配空白行的正则表达式:ns*r
以下是经常使用的正则表达式的写法,有使用的时候可以拿来看看。 只能输入数字:"^[0-9]*$"。 只能输入n位的数字:"^\d{n}$"。 只能输入至少n位的数字:"^\d{n,}$"。 只能输入m~n位的数字:。"^\d{m,n}$" 只能输入零和非零开头的数字:"^(0|[1-9][0-9]*)$"。 只能输入有两位小数的正实数:"^[0-9]+(.[0-9]{2})?$"。 只能输入有1~
  get、set属性 在.NET的编译过程中get、set属性转化为get_func()、set_func(xxx)方法。 因此对于反编译出来的代码,逐个替换可能很慢,可以采用下面正则表达式分别进行查找替换:  对于get访问器: \.get_{[^\(\)]+}\(\)       替换为   \.\1  对于set访问器: \.set_{[^\(]+}\({[^\)]+}\)      替换
只能输入1个数字  表达式 ^/d$ 描述 匹配一个数字 匹配的例子 0,1,2,3 不匹配的例子   只能输入n个数字    表达式 ^/d{n}$ 例如^/d{8}$ 描述 匹配8个数字 匹配的例子 12345678,22223334,12344321 不匹配的例子   只能输入至少n个数字    表达式 ^/d{n,}$ 例如^/d{8,}$ 描述 匹配最少n个数字 匹配的例子 123456
平时做网站经常要用正则表达式,下面是一些讲解和例子,仅供大家参考和修改使用:  2.    "^\d+$"  //非负整数(正整数 + 0)  3.    "^[0-9]*[1-9][0-9]*$"  //正整数  4.    "^((-\d+)|(0+))$"  //非正整数(负整数 + 0)  5.    "^-[0-9]*[1-9][0-9]*$"  //负整数  6.    "^-?\d+
整理常用的正则 邮箱正则 \w[-\w.+]*@([A-Za-z0-9][-A-Za-z0-9]+\.)+[A-Za-z]{2,14} 匹配中文 [\u4e00-\u9fa5] 匹配双字节字符(包含汉字) [^\x00-\xff] 匹配时间(时:分:秒) ([01]?\d|2[0-3]):[0-5]?\d:[0-5]?\d 匹配IP(IPV4) (\d+)\.(\d+)\.(\d+)\.(\d+)
【工具名称】 Expresso 【下载】 http://www.ultrapico.com/ExpressoDownload.htm 【功能】 正则表达式解析、调试;正则表达式库,……
直接可以拿去用的正则验证表达式 为了方便自己也方便初学的学弟们,自己总结了网上的众多正则验证式,现分享给大家,可以直接拿去用。 一、校验数字的  1 数字:^[0-9]*$  2 n位的数字:^\d{n}$  3 至少n位的数字:^\d{n,}$  4 m-n位的数字:^\d{m,n}$  5 零和非零开头的数字:^(0|[1-9][0-9]*)$  6 非零开头的最多带两位小数的数字:^([1-